Two Italian School Paintings in the Classical Taste
Lot Details & Additional Photographs
The first a gouache and watercolor on paper by Vincenzo Loria (Italian, 1850-1939), signed at lower left, circa 1890, depicting a maenad tormenting a centaur, matted and framed under glass, retaining a label for Sherman Galleries of Newport News, Virginia to verso (Frame dimensions 20 x 21 1/8 in.); the second a watercolor on paper, indistinct signature at lower left, depicting classical ruins on a hillside, matted and framed under glass (Frame dimensions 19 x 15 in.).

The Collection of the late Mr. William Hulbert, Chesapeake, Virginia

Both in good estate condition; neither examined out of the frame.
